Privé Revaux names new GM, COO

Privé Revaux on Tuesday announced the promotion of company president George Schmidt to the role of general manager, coinciding with the appointment of Maureen Cavanagh to the role of chief operating officer.


Privé Reveaux


The Miami, Florida-based eyewear company said Schmidt, who has served in the role of president since November, has been serving as general manager since January 21. In the new role, Schmidt ​will provide leadership and strategic direction to the brand and help drive growth as Privé Revaux continues to expand.

​“I came to Privé Revaux with the goal of galvanizing growth for an already extraordinary business,” said Schmidt. “The combination of stylish, high-quality eyewear at an accessible price point and engagement of our celebrity co-founders provides an enormous competitive advantage, which I am excited to be a part of.”

A ​senior executive with expertise in strategic planning, multi-channel marketing, ecommerce and merchandising leadership, Schmidt began his career at L.L.Bean, Inc. as marketing manager of corporate sales. Before joining Privé Revaux, he served as vice president and general manager of Cheryl’s Cookies. 

Likewise, Cavanagh joined Privé Revaux in April last year as senior vice president of global sales. In her new role as COO, Cavanagh will continue to accelerate the brand’s global growth trajectory, the company said.

Italian eyewear giant Safilo acquired U.S.-based Privé Revaux in February 2020.

The two appointments are expected to help take the brand further in line with its current strategy, which includes leveraging Safilo’s infrastructure to continue expansion into untapped markets, streamlining back-end operations to deliver exceptional customer service and elevating brand awareness through social media and influencer campaigns, the company added.
